Full specifications

Specification Z50 (2019)Z6 (2018)
Price £499 £749
Sensor APS-C CMOS Full-frame BSI CMOS 35mm
Resolution 20.9MP 24.5MP
Video 4K 30fps (1.5× crop), 1080p 120fps 4K 30fps (full-width), 1080p 120fps
Autofocus 209-point phase-detect hybrid AF 273-point phase-detect hybrid AF
Stabilisation None 5-axis IBIS, 5.0 stops
Burst Rate 11fps 12fps
Battery Life 300 shots (CIPA) 310 shots (CIPA)
Weight 397g (body only) 585g (body only)
Dimensions 126.5 × 93.5 × 60.0mm 134.0 × 100.5 × 67.5mm
Weather Sealed No Yes
Viewfinder EVF 0.68× 2.36M-dot EVF 0.80× 3.69M-dot
Screen 3.2" downward-tilting touchscreen, 1.04M-dot 3.2" tilting touchscreen, 2.1M-dot
Mount Nikon Z-Mount (DX) Nikon Z-Mount
Memory Cards Single SD UHS-I Single XQD / CFexpress Type B
Connectivity Wi-Fi, Bluetooth 4.2, Micro USB, Micro HDMI Wi-Fi, Bluetooth 4.2, USB-C 3.1, HDMI
